Strongs Number: G4916
- Greek Word
- συνθάπτω
- Transliteration
- sunthaptō
- Phonetic
- soon-thap'-to
- Part of Speech
- Verb
- Strongs Definition
-
to inter in company with that is (figuratively) to assimilate spiritually (to Christ by a sepulture as to sin)
- Thayers Definition
-
1. to bury together with
- Origin
- From G4862 and G2290
- Bible Usage
- bury with.
